1. The Science Behind Those Cute Spots 🧪

Freckles, those adorable little dots on your skin, are actually a result of melanin production. Melanin is the pigment that gives color to your hair, eyes, and skin. When your skin is exposed to the sun, it produces more melanin to protect itself from UV rays. For some people, this extra melanin clumps together, forming freckles. 🌞✨
But here’s the fun part: not everyone gets freckles. It all comes down to genetics. If your parents have freckles, chances are you will too. It’s like inheriting a secret code for sun-kissed charm. 😎🧬

2. Genetics: The Freckle Factor 🧬

The MC1R gene is the key player in the freckle game. This gene controls the type of melanin produced in your body. People with certain variations of the MC1R gene are more likely to have freckles. It’s like having a genetic recipe for a sun-kissed look. 🍼🧬

3. Sun Exposure: The Freckle Booster ☀️

While genetics set the stage, sun exposure is the director of the freckle show. When UV rays hit your skin, they trigger melanin production. This can cause existing freckles to darken or new ones to appear. It’s like the sun is painting little dots on your skin. 🎨☀️
But be careful! Too much sun exposure can lead to skin damage and increase the risk of skin cancer. Always wear sunscreen and protect your skin, even if you love your freckles. 🌞🛡️

4. Embracing Your Freckles: Tips and Tricks 💆‍♀️

If you love your freckles, embrace them! They’re a unique part of who you are. But if you prefer to minimize their appearance, there are a few tips and tricks to help:
- **Sunscreen**: Apply a broad-spectrum SPF 30 or higher daily to prevent freckles from darkening. 🌞:
- **Exfoliation**: Gently exfoliate your skin once or twice a week to remove dead skin cells and promote a more even skin tone. 🧽:
- **Skincare Products**: Use products with ingredients like vitamin C, niacinamide, and kojic acid to lighten freckles and brighten your complexion. 💆‍♀️:
